Sightseeing

Baguio is an artist’s haven and what better way to celebrate creativity than to visit National Artist, Bencab’s museum that showcases his work and those of other artists. It also features a picturesque garden that blends very well with the natural landscape as well as a cafe that serves great pasta and refreshing drinks. Bring a car when you visit since it’s a little out of the way and hailing a cab may take a while if you decide to commute. In any case, it’s definitely worth a visit!

Watch the magnificent sun rise across the Cordillera mountain ranges in a sea of clouds at the Mines View Park and witness this scene take your breath away. Try to come very early to avoid the crowd and get the best view of nature’s daily miracle. For a memorable experience, watch the sunrise with a hot strawberry-flavored taho or soy bean curd in hand!

Mirador Hill Peace Memorial is known for its Japanese historical significance and ambiance. Visitors take some time taking photos at its bamboo garden and the famous red arch with the panoramic view of the city as the backdrop. The trek can be a challenge here so best to condition your mind and body. But if you’re just here for the gram, ask the guards to let you in by the exit to click your cam then go.

The Baguio Public Market is a one-stop-shop for all your fresh and dry ingredients needs. Fresh fruits and vegetables are available all day, but the coffee and tablea at the famous Garcia’s Premium Coffee Shop may come short when you come later in the day (the line is long), so do this first thing in the morning!
